PMI's Body of Knowledge : Essential Tools for Project Managers

The PMBOK Body of Knowledge (BoK) is an essential resource for any seasoned project manager. This comprehensive guide outlines the skills and processes required to successfully manage programs. By understanding the BoK's model, project managers can successfully plan, execute, monitor, and close projects.

  • The BoK provides a shared language for project management.
  • This guide covers a wide range of project management disciplines, including initiation, planning, execution, monitoring and controlling, and closing.
  • Management managers can use the BoK to enhance their skills and knowledge.

In today's dynamic business environment, staying up-to-date on best practices is crucial for project success. The BoK serves as a valuable tool to help project managers navigate the complexities of modern projects and achieve their goals.
